Popular Ingredients Featured in Shaking Bowls
The ingredient list for shaking bowls is extensive and diverse, encompassing fresh vegetables, lean proteins, whole grains, and vibrant dressings. The selection reflects both health-conscious choices and bold flavor combinations.
Vegetables like kale, spinach, carrots, and bell peppers provide a nutrient-dense base rich in fiber and vitamins. Proteins range from grilled chicken and tofu to seafood and legumes, catering to omnivores and vegetarians alike.
Whole grains such as quinoa, brown rice, and bulgur add texture and sustained energy. Dressings elevate the bowls with tangy, savory, or sweet notes, often crafted from citrus juices, oils, herbs, and spices.
Highlighting Key Ingredients
- Leafy Greens: Spinach, kale, arugula – rich in iron and antioxidants
- Proteins: Grilled chicken, chickpeas, salmon, tempeh – essential for muscle repair and satiety
- Grains: Quinoa, farro, brown rice – provide complex carbohydrates and fiber
- Dressings: Lemon-tahini, balsamic vinaigrette, spicy peanut sauce – add moisture and flavor depth
Ingredient | Nutritional Benefit | Flavor Profile |
Quinoa | High in protein and fiber | Nutty, slightly chewy |
Grilled Chicken | Lean protein, low fat | Savory, mild |
Kale | Rich in vitamins A, C, K | Bitter, earthy |
Lemon-Tahini Dressing | Healthy fats, vitamin E | Tangy, creamy |

Popular Shaking Bowl Combinations and Flavors
Shaking bowls offer endless possibilities, but some combinations have become crowd favorites due to their harmonious flavor profiles and nutritional balance. These signature mixes inspire both chefs and home cooks alike.
One popular combination features grilled chicken, quinoa, kale, cherry tomatoes, and a lemon-tahini dressing. The nutty quinoa and creamy dressing contrast beautifully with the slightly bitter kale and juicy tomatoes.
Another favorite is the vegan bowl with chickpeas, brown rice, spinach, roasted sweet potatoes, and a spicy peanut sauce. The sweetness of the potatoes balances the heat of the sauce while providing a comforting texture.
Examples of Signature Bowls
- Protein-Packed Power Bowl: Grilled salmon, wild rice, mixed greens, avocado, citrus vinaigrette
- Vegan Delight: Tempeh, quinoa, kale, shredded carrots, ginger-soy dressing
- Asian Fusion: Tofu, soba noodles, cucumber, edamame, sesame-ginger dressing
- Southwest Fiesta: Black beans, brown rice, corn, avocado, chipotle-lime dressing
Bowl Name | Main Ingredients | Taste Profile |
Protein-Packed Power | Salmon, wild rice, avocado | Rich, creamy, citrusy |
Vegan Delight | Tempeh, quinoa, kale | Earthy, tangy, savory |
Asian Fusion | Tofu, soba noodles, edamame | Umami, nutty, fresh |
Southwest Fiesta | Black beans, corn, avocado | Spicy, smoky, creamy |
How to Create Your Own Shaking Bowl at Home
Crafting a shaking bowl at home allows for complete control over ingredients and flavors, making it a fun and rewarding culinary project. The process is simple and adaptable to various tastes.
Start by choosing a base of greens or grains, then select a protein source that fits your dietary needs. Add a variety of colorful vegetables for both nutrition and visual appeal.
Finally, select or prepare a dressing that complements the ingredients.
Once all components are assembled in a sturdy container, shake vigorously to combine. This step ensures that the dressing coats every ingredient evenly, enhancing the overall taste and texture.
Step-by-Step Guide
- Choose a base: Leafy greens, cooked grains, or a combination
- Add protein: Cooked chicken, tofu, beans, or seafood
- Include vegetables: Fresh, roasted, or pickled varieties
- Select dressing: Homemade or store-bought, tailored to flavor preferences
- Shake well: Use a lidded container to mix ingredients thoroughly

Tips for Maximizing Flavor and Nutrition in Shaking Bowls
To get the most from a shaking bowl, attention to ingredient quality and preparation techniques is essential. Balancing flavors and textures enhances enjoyment and nutritional value.
Choosing fresh, ripe vegetables and properly cooked proteins ensures optimal taste and digestibility. Dressings should complement rather than overpower the other ingredients, with a focus on natural flavors and healthy fats.
Incorporating a variety of textures—crunchy, creamy, soft—creates a more satisfying eating experience. It’s also important to consider portion sizes to maintain balanced calorie intake.
Practical Suggestions
- Use fresh herbs: Cilantro, basil, or mint brighten flavors
- Incorporate nuts or seeds: Add crunch and healthy fats
- Balance acidity: Lemon juice or vinegar can elevate taste
- Mind portion control: Avoid overloading with dressings or grains
